Senior Java Developer applicants have rated the interview process at Publicis Sapient with 2.7 out of 5 (where 5 is the highest level of difficulty) and assessed their interview experience as 67% positive. To compare, the company-average is 65.1% positive. This is according to Glassdoor user ratings.
Candidates applying for Senior Java Developer roles take an average of 4 days to get hired, when considering 3 user submitted interviews for this role. To compare, the hiring process at Publicis Sapient overall takes an average of 21 days.
Common stages of the interview process at Publicis Sapient as a Senior Java Developer according to 3 Glassdoor interviews include:
One on one interview: 23%
Phone interview: 23%
Background check: 15%
Group panel interview: 15%
Presentation: 15%
Skills test: 8%

I applied through a recruiter. The process took 1 week. I interviewed at Publicis Sapient (Bengaluru) in Dec 2020
Interview
I had applied online through a recruiter portal.
The HR call came a day later.
HR was polite and methodical in his questions.
The interviewers were ok-ok.
They were punctual, knowledgeable and considerate of my prior commitments.
When I could not answer a question, they explained the solution politely, unlike my previous experience in other interviews.
Interview questions [1]
Question 1
Core Java concepts like Multi-threading
What is the difference between REST API and RESTful API?
How can you print even-odd numbers using 2 threads?

I applied online. I interviewed at Publicis Sapient (Gurgaon, Haryana) in Sep 2024
Interview
The coordinator asked me to show the entire room on video call before starting the interview which was quite odd. They have interview process of 2 hours which is another odd thing. The company can divide the interviews into two rounds of 1 hour instead of a 2 hour interview. The interviewer asked me open the IDE in my system to write the program.
Interview questions [11]
Question 1
Coding question on finding the count of longest consecutive numbers in an array and optimize it using collection.
Have you checked how the system in allocating memory in your project and how will troubleshoot in case of out of memory error in production environment?
